This paper describes a new approach to SLAM problems using low quality range data. Vision sensors are useful for acquiring various kinds of environmental information but range data obtained by stereo vision is less reliable than other active sensors like laser range finders. False stereo matches often result in spurious obstacles, which may degrade the map when directly used in existing SLAM methods...

This paper describes a method of simultaneously estimating the road region and the ego-motion for outdoor mobile robots. Temporal integration of sensor data is effective for robust estimation of road region. To integrate sensor data obtained at multiple places, the robotpsilas ego-motion has to be estimated simultaneously. It is also necessary to use multiple sensors for reliable estimation because...
